The Hotel Eutaw was built between 1926 and 1927 at a cost of $173,800. Prominent southeastern architect G. Lloyd Preacher designed the Hotel Eutaw. The Hotel Eutaw was financed through a stock subscription project which involved many citizens of Orangeburg working through three community-action groups, the Young Men’s Business League, the Lion’s Club, and the Rotary Club.
Location: Orangeburg, South Carolina.
